What Are Carbon Offsets?

Carbon offsets are actions taken to counterbalance carbon dioxide emissions by funding projects that reduce or remove equivalent CO2 from the atmosphere. Organizations buy voluntary carbon offsets, often in the form of renewable energy carbon credits, to compensate for their impact on the environment, which can be achieved through sustainable initiatives like energy-efficient measures, reforestation, and reducing harmful industrial processes.

Why Is Carbon Offsetting Important?

Large corporations and organizations are major contributors to greenhouse gas (GHG) emissions, particularly carbon dioxide. By buying voluntary carbon offsets or carbon offset credits, these organizations can compensate for their impact on the environment and meet large sustainability goals, such as becoming carbon neutral or producing net zero emissions. A company that chooses carbon offsetting can distinguish itself from competitors and improve its brand reputation. Plus, carbon offsetting appeals to customers, employees, and other stakeholders who are concerned about the environment.

Organizations can demonstrate their commitment to sustainability by choosing the carbon offset type that best fits their needs and goals. However, it is important to understand all types of carbon offsets and their credibility.

Types of Carbon Offsets

Various types of corporate carbon offsets are available for your organization to choose from, each with unique focuses and benefits. Some of the most common types of carbon offsets and related sustainable projects are:

Greenhouse Gas Emissions Offset

Greenhouse gas emissions offsets are general strategies that directly reduce emissions, such as investing in renewable energy, enhancing energy efficiency, or supporting emission-reduction projects in other sectors. These offsets play a critical role in balancing out the emissions produced by an organization by contributing to projects that have a tangible impact on reducing global GHG levels.

Renewable Energy Offsets

Renewable energy offsets, also known as renewable energy carbon credits, are linked to projects that harness renewable sources like wind, solar, hydro, biomass, and landfill gas for electricity generation. Investing in these credits allows companies to actively promote the expansion of clean energy. This support is vital for shifting away from reliance on fossil fuels and advancing towards a more sustainable, eco-friendly power generation model.

Carbon Sequestration Offsets

Carbon sequestration offsets involve activities that capture and store atmospheric carbon dioxide, such as reforestation, afforestation, and soil carbon projects. These offsets are vital for their role in physically removing CO2 from the atmosphere, a key element in combating climate change.

 Carbon Offset Electricity

Carbon offset electricity involves investing in or purchasing electricity generated from low-carbon or renewable sources. By doing so, companies offset their own electricity usage, which traditionally relies on fossil fuels, thereby reducing their carbon footprint and supporting the development of green energy infrastructure.

Nature-Based Solutions (NBS)

Nature-based solutions (NBS) support activities like tree planting in degraded areas (reforestation and afforestation), paying stakeholders to not cut down trees (avoided deforestation), improved forest management (sustainable forestry practices), agricultural soil carbon sequestration, and wetlands restoration.

Energy Efficiency Technologies

Offsetting with energy efficiency technologies can include upgrading to energy-efficient lighting and HVAC systems, improving building insulation, and replacing outdated and inefficient appliances. These measures not only reduce overall energy consumption but also decrease reliance on fossil fuels, contributing to a reduction in greenhouse gas emissions.

Industrial Processes

Industrial processes typically refer to capturing and destroying methane and other ozone-depleting substances (ODS). Various industrial sectors use ODS in refrigeration, air conditioning, and the production of insulating foam and cushioning. This may involve transitioning to less harmful refrigerants, implementing energy-efficient manufacturing processes, and adopting waste reduction strategies.

What Makes Carbon Offsets Credible?

Before choosing the type of corporate carbon offset project you’d like to pursue, you must consider its credibility. Credibility is essential in evaluating the trustworthiness, reliability, and effectiveness of an offset project and the organization behind it. Thankfully, there are independent project registries and industry standards organizations that can help evaluate the credibility of carbon offset solutions in the offset market.

The Verra registry and the International Council for the Voluntary Carbon Market (ICVCM) are two independent organizations that use the latest technologies and techniques to track and audit high-quality projects. Together, they have jointly released the "Common Core Principles," which serve as the gold standard for carbon offset programs.

These core principles are based on three main concepts: additionality, permanence, and risk of leakage.

Additionality

Carbon offset additionality means that a renewable project is only possible with financial investment in carbon offsets. If the project did not lead to additional greenhouse gas emissions reductions, then the reductions are not additional. To determine this, we must assess whether or not the project can be sustained financially without the revenue from carbon offset and whether the emissions reductions would not have occurred otherwise.

Additionality Example

For instance, a landfill gas project that captures and destroys methane emissions that would have otherwise been released into the atmosphere might be considered additional since it may not have been economically viable without the revenue from carbon offset.

Permanence

Permanence is a crucial factor in ensuring that carbon removed or avoided by a project stays out of the atmosphere for a significant period of time. This is evaluated by reviewing the project's plan for maintaining the long-term durability of the carbon emissions reductions or removals achieved.

Permanence Example

For instance, a forestry project could ensure permanence of emissions removals by implementing a comprehensive monitoring and enforcement system to prevent illegal logging and land-use change. The project could also offer sustainable jobs to the local community in monitoring and enforcement, which is a potential "co-benefit" of the project.

Risk of Leakage

Leakage refers to the possibility of unintended consequences that result in increased emissions elsewhere. To avoid this, it is important to assess and mitigate the risks and ensure that the project does not negatively impact the environment or society in any other area or way.

Risk of Leakage Example

For instance, installing efficient cookstoves in a rural community may save money, but if the community uses the savings to buy more polluting products and services, it could lead to increased emissions elsewhere.

How to Evaluate an Offset Provider

Choosing an offset provider that shares your organization's sustainability objectives is crucial. An offset provider's credibility can be determined by its reputation and experience. Effective partners who have previously assisted corporations can provide a valuable resource along a complex decision-making path. Let’s consider factors such as track record, third-party standards and certifications, project stakeholder engagement, and reporting with transparency.

Track Record

When searching for advisors, prioritize those who have a successful track record in providing and managing carbon offsets. Review their portfolio of projects, along with their impact, to determine whether they align with your goals. Advisors who have expertise in providing current and future guidance and management at a project or portfolio level are critical to success.

Certifications and Standards

Ensure the provider adheres to internationally recognized standard bodies such as the Integrity Council on Voluntary Carbon Markets (ICVCM) or registries such as Verified Carbon Standard (VCS), Climate Action Reserve, or American Carbon Registry. These certifications provide specific rules of the road that increase the credibility and integrity of projects.

Stakeholder Engagement

Review and assess how the advisor engages with project developers, standards bodies, and community organizations. Strong internal and external stakeholder relationships foster transparency, accountability, and long-term success in alignment with your corporation’s sustainability pathway.

Reporting With Transparency

When choosing a provider, it is also imperative to consider their reporting methods. Transparent reporting ensures accountability and builds trust with stakeholders. Some common avenues of data acquisition and reporting are documentation, third-party verification, and communication with stakeholders.

Documentation:

Review the provider's reporting practices, including their methodologies for calculating carbon reductions, monitoring project progress, and verifying the effectiveness of projects. Look for comprehensive and auditable documentation.

Third-Party Verification:

A reputable offset provider should engage independent third-party auditors to verify and validate their projects' carbon reductions. This external validation enhances the credibility of the offset projects.

Communication:

Assess the provider's communication practices. They should provide clear and accessible information to stakeholders, including regular reports on project performance, carbon reduction metrics, and the social and environmental co-benefits achieved.

FAQs: Carbon Offsets

What are carbon offsets?

Carbon offsets are measures taken by individuals or organizations to compensate for their carbon dioxide emissions by investing in projects that reduce or remove an equivalent amount of carbon from the atmosphere.

What are the benefits of carbon offsets?

Carbon offsets balance out greenhouse gas emissions and are a practical way to tackle climate change. By investing in projects like reforestation, renewable energy initiatives, or sustainability programs, individuals and companies can offset their carbon footprint, while also providing social, economic, and environmental benefits to communities. For instance, reforestation helps in biodiversity conservation and water regulation, while renewable energy projects reduce reliance on fossil fuels and create local job opportunities.

How do carbon offsets help combat climate change?

Carbon offsets contribute to climate change mitigation by funding projects that either reduce the emission of greenhouse gases or capture and store existing carbon dioxide, thereby reducing the overall amount of carbon in the atmosphere.

What types of projects are commonly used for carbon offsets?

Common projects include renewable energy (like wind and solar power), reforestation and afforestation, energy efficiency upgrades, and methane capture from waste management and industrial processes.

How can a company ensure the credibility of a carbon offset project?

Companies should look for projects that are verified by reputable third-party organizations and adhere to international standards. These projects should demonstrate additionality, permanence, and a low risk of leakage.

Are carbon offsets the same as carbon credits?

Carbon offsets refer to the action of compensating for emissions, while carbon credits are the quantifiable units (usually measured in tonnes of CO2 equivalent) that represent this compensation. One carbon credit typically equals one tonne of CO2 offset.

Can carbon offsets make a company carbon neutral?

Carbon offsets can be part of a company's strategy to achieve carbon neutrality. This is achieved when the amount of carbon emissions produced by the company is balanced by an equivalent amount offset.

How are carbon offsets calculated?

Carbon offsets are calculated based on the reduction or removal of carbon dioxide (or other greenhouse gases) from the atmosphere by a particular project. This calculation involves evaluating the baseline emissions (the emissions that would have occurred without the project) and the emissions after the project is implemented. The difference between these two figures represents the amount of emissions offset. The calculations must adhere to specific methodologies and are frequently verified by independent third parties to ensure accuracy and integrity. For example, one tonne of carbon offset represents the reduction or removal of one tonne of carbon dioxide from the atmosphere.

What is the difference between renewable energy offsets and carbon offset electricity?

Renewable energy offsets are investments in renewable energy projects that reduce the need for fossil-fuel-based energy production. Carbon offset electricity specifically refers to the purchase of electricity generated from renewable sources to offset traditional energy use.

How do nature-based solutions (NBS) contribute to carbon offsets?

NBS, such as reforestation or wetlands restoration, help capture and store carbon dioxide from the atmosphere, thereby directly reducing the amount of greenhouse gases.

What role do energy efficiency technologies play in carbon offsetting?

Investing in energy efficiency technologies reduces the overall energy demand and consumption, which in turn lowers the amount of carbon emissions associated with energy production, especially from fossil fuels.

Can individuals participate in carbon offsetting?

Yes, individuals can contribute to carbon offsetting by investing in carbon offset projects, reducing their own carbon footprint through lifestyle changes, or purchasing carbon credits.
